Two markets in SWKH to be closed

Mawkyrwat: Two major markets under Ranikor Civil Sub Division in South West Khasi District will be closed for one day on October 5 and 7 due to COVID-19, district magistrate HS Diengdoh informed on Sunday.
The order came in after one person who is a shopkeeper and has shops in both Balat and Photkroh markets was tested positive recently.
‘Public health and safety is a matter of concern and therefore it is imperative to control and regulate the commercial areas’, Diengdoh said.
Therefore in order to contain the spread of COVID-19 and to allow the health department to conduct contact tracing in both the markets, unregulated opening of Balat market on October 5 and Photkroh market on October 7 is prohibited, he added.
Meanwhile the deputy commissioner of South West Khasi Hills, Cara Kharkongor has declared the house of Roilin Sangriang in Mawsaw Domsohpian village and the house of Loristhan Pariong of Thangrai village in Nongnah, as containment areas after detection of new positive cases.
